Production & maintenance

A skilled position in German mechanical engineering stays open 106 days at the median (own analysis, 23,707 Federal Agency postings, 2026). After roughly 120 days of vacancy, the cost exceeds a full annual gross salary – calculated at a factor of three, the midpoint of the common range of two to four. The machinists are out there – they simply do not apply to companies whose machine park, shift model and allowance appear nowhere.

  6. 06 From what company size does this pay off?
    Against placement fees of 15 to 25 percent of annual salary, a system pays off from two technical roles a year – with 10 to 15 percent turnover in industrial and technical roles that corresponds to roughly 50 employees. Below that we will tell you an agency is the cheaper math, rather than building you something you cannot use to capacity.
